The Role

As an Associate Product Manager, you will play a critical role in shaping the AI-driven future of technology.  You will join our product organization in an intensive 2-year rotational experience that allows you to develop your skills as a hands-on, technical AI product manager and learn to "PM the Salesforce way." You will gain experience building and managing products across diverse teams, get direct exposure to senior executives, and work with formal mentors to build your career in the AI era.

Responsibilities
  • Embed within a small AI pods to rapidly prototype, test, and iterate on agentic features — moving from customer problem to working solution in tight cycles

  • Understand and analyze user needs to define how autonomous agents can solve complex, multi-step business problems — including edge cases, failure modes, and trust boundaries

  • Define success criteria and evaluation frameworks for agentic behaviors, including agent telemetry, grounding quality, and escalation paths

  • Analyze market trends, competitor frameworks, qualitative customer research and quantitative product usage and agent performance signals to drive fast, informed iteration 

  • Help define a product strategy that moves beyond static features toward autonomous, context-aware collaborators.

  • Partner with designers to create intuitive user experiences where humans and AI agents work together seamlessly.

  • Work with engineers and designers to build and launch features

  • Help evangelize product vision through presentations to stakeholders

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
